Transaction 04491123445f5455f09eb34ddf453cb43ee96c7ab34237655df41b3a63fd66d0

4 Input
2 Outputs
  • 04491123445f5455f09eb34ddf453cb43ee96c7ab34237655df41b3a63fd66d0:0
  • value  20310486
    address  3JNPFwfaQBx7iNb2BVgE2DMegM1afVYVfV
  • 04491123445f5455f09eb34ddf453cb43ee96c7ab34237655df41b3a63fd66d0:1
  • value  21396309
    address  3BMEXSuacKgrsF77TsmWaJWgLyWgBACqfc